In 2020-21, operating revenues were $10.3 million, down from $39.6 million the year prior. On Wednesday during the clubs annual general meeting, the team announced a loss of $7.5 million for the 2020-21 fiscal year, mainly due to the cancelled 2020 football season during the COVID-19 pandemic. The Saskatchewan Roughriders announce a $7.5 million dollar loss in 2020-21. Last year, the football ops department cost the team just $4.8 million, compared to $13.5 million the year prior.
